上一页 1 ··· 24 25 26 27 28 29 30 31 32 ··· 73 下一页
摘要: "题目" 这道题目实际上可以用动态规划来做。 对于每个区间,我们从右边边界,往左边走,如果能走n 1次,那说明以右边边界为起点存在一个题目中说的子链。 利用倍增算法,实际上倍增也是动态规划。f[i][j] 表示以i为结尾,能够往前走 2^j 次所到达的位置。 最后就是寻找以每个点为右边边界,往前走, 阅读全文
posted @ 2019-04-24 10:14 Shendu.CC 阅读(190) 评论(0) 推荐(0) 编辑
摘要: "题目" 水题,dfs include include include using namespace std; define MAX 100000 struct Node { int value; int c; int next; }edge[MAX+5]; int pos; int head[M 阅读全文
posted @ 2019-04-16 15:54 Shendu.CC 阅读(106) 评论(0) 推荐(0) 编辑
摘要: "题目" 解题思路 关键是要 ,找出L 的组合,然后遍历L的组合,用最大公约数就可以算出来当前L的值要停多少次 怎么找出L的组合呢?饭店是每隔K 有一个,是重复的,我们只需要算出第一个饭店两侧,起点和停顿点的情况,之后再加上k 1 ,k 2,k 3 就能得出所有L的组合。 数据范围是 10万,所以必 阅读全文
posted @ 2019-04-12 13:59 Shendu.CC 阅读(154) 评论(0) 推荐(0) 编辑
摘要: "题目" 解决思路是,每个位上都是9的情况,遍历一下就可以了。 include using namespace std; int n; int a[35]; int main() { scanf("%d",&n); int tag=0; while(n) { a[tag]=n%10; n=n/10; 阅读全文
posted @ 2019-04-11 11:34 Shendu.CC 阅读(153) 评论(0) 推荐(0) 编辑
摘要: "The Doors" 签到题 阅读全文
posted @ 2019-04-11 08:58 Shendu.CC 阅读(189) 评论(0) 推荐(0) 编辑
摘要: 上一篇 "手写AVL树上" 实现了AVL树的插入和查询 上代码: 头文件:AVL.h 源文件:AVL.cpp 阅读全文
posted @ 2019-04-10 20:06 Shendu.CC 阅读(120) 评论(0) 推荐(0) 编辑
摘要: "题目" 实现一个缓存机制。很多人的写法都是使用HashTable, Map,Dictionary 或者别的工具。 但是我,自己硬核手写了一个可插入删除的AVL树,并且把这道题目给过了 代码实在有点偏长,以后再重构代码。 过程中Wa了很多次,最后一次的AC的感觉,真是找到以前比赛时候的感觉。 阅读全文
posted @ 2019-04-09 14:23 Shendu.CC 阅读(179) 评论(1) 推荐(0) 编辑
摘要: 这篇博客并不是证明Lucene.net的性能有多强悍,实际上Lucene.net的并发能力并不让人很满意,这得看你怎么用它。 因为Lucene 本身就是一个搜索引擎的基础框架,相当于一辆车子的发动机,而你做的是怎么造出一辆车速度快的车子来。很显然你要有一个好的轮胎,和空气阻力很小的车身造型。如果你的 阅读全文
posted @ 2019-04-08 11:15 Shendu.CC 阅读(345) 评论(0) 推荐(0) 编辑
摘要: KMP: csharp public int KMP (ReadOnlySpan content, ReadOnlySpan span) { _next = new int[span.Length]; GetNext (span); int i = 0; int j = 0; while (i = 阅读全文
posted @ 2019-04-04 20:08 Shendu.CC 阅读(166) 评论(0) 推荐(0) 编辑
摘要: 前言 最近做了一个过滤代码块功能的接口。就是获取一些博客文章做文本处理,然后这些博客文章的代码块太多了,很多重复的代码关键词如果被拿过来处理,那么会对文本的特征表示已经特征选择会有很大的影响。所以需要将这些代码块的部分给过滤掉。过滤起来很简单,就是找代码块的html 标记,然后将html标记之间的内 阅读全文
posted @ 2019-04-04 10:03 Shendu.CC 阅读(4761) 评论(6) 推荐(19) 编辑
上一页 1 ··· 24 25 26 27 28 29 30 31 32 ··· 73 下一页